#220621 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#220621 is composed of 13.3% red, 2.4%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.4% magenta, 2.9% yellow and 86.7% black. It has a hue angle of 302.1 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 7.8%. #220621 color hex could be obtained by blending #440c42 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#220621
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fceff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#220621
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#141414 is the less saturated color, while #270125 is the most saturated one.
